I was disappointed, but not surprised, that you chose to endorse only one Republican candidate in the national general election this week. You also have condemned each of the Legislature's propositions placed on the ballot.
I am not surprised because you have long shown by your editorial positions that you are fundamentally an organ of the Democrat Party.
I am particularly disappointed that you have taken a position on abortion, an issue that divides the state and which will continue to do so long after your one-sided endorsements are forgotten.
A better newspaper, with some respect for the many Tucsonans who do not share your progressive views, would have avoided making endorsements.
I continue my paid subscription only because you have a newspaper monopoly in Tucson.
